‘Lads’ Caught on Camera Repairing Bike Rack

A rare example of community spirit caught on CCTV has been released to the public.

In what one councillor called a “remarkable” example of public-spirited behaviour, up to five young men were caught on public video surveillance repairing a bike stand that had been damaged by a car hitting it.

The footage was recorded at around 3 a.m. on the streets of Boston, Lincolnshire, and released by Boston Borough Council this week. The damage to the bike stand had been reported to the council, but by the time council workers came to repair it, they found the job had already been done.

Peter Hunn, Boston Borough Council’s principal community safety officer, said:

We recorded the whole sequence. At first two lads had a go and then encouraged others to help. At one point five were pushing and pulling. To look at the bike rack now you would hardly know it had been damaged.

The young men were waiting outside a kebab shop at the time the footage was recorded. Hunn continued to say how this shows that “the night-time economy is not all about bad lads doing bad things.”

Meanwhile, Councillor Stephen Woodliffe told the BBC:

Young people often get a bad press and this shows there are some who want to contribute to their society and do the right thing.
It shows young people acting in a very positive and constructive manner and shows they have a good and responsible attitude to what’s happening in their town.
